The Putnam Arts Lecture Hall is run by the Keene State Film Society. We choose and screen a variety of films for students and local residents to enjoy. Offering the lowest ticket prices around ($5 general admission, $4 seniors, $3.50 matinees and $2 for students), we offer the best bang for your movie-going buck.
We screen classics, indies, foreign, art house, and the occasional blockbuster.
